Output 4381c81069d51aaa581a1fae0286ce5eadd0e7ca9b0d84ae024982758440a342:0

value
25000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c38236c8fc2b199587c5aa3713571344a5a4eedb OP_EQUAL
address
3KWmgNtuaaDquoddkNnmsJjt6Uu2DbAvfD
transaction
4381c81069d51aaa581a1fae0286ce5eadd0e7ca9b0d84ae024982758440a342
confirmations
141175
spent
true